A:LINK{ text-decoration : none;  
  color : #666666;
  font-size : 12px;
}
A:VISITED{ text-decoration : none;  
  font-size : 12px;
  color : #999999;
}
A:HOVER{ text-decoration:underline; color:#FF6699; 
  font-size : 12px;
}
BODY{ font-size : 12px; color : #666666;  background-image:url(); margin-left : 0px; margin-right:4%; 
  font-family : Tahoma;
  line-height : 25px;
  
  
  margin-top : 0px;
  text-align : left;
}
TR,TD{ font-size : 12px; color : #666666; }
hr{ color:#aaaaaa; }
#mid{ font-size:11pt; }
#small{ font-size:10pt; }
#kanri{ color:#ff9999; } /* 管理人コメントの色 */
#log{ width:630; border-style : double double double double; border-color : #999999 #999999 #999999 #999999; border-width : 3px 3px 3px 3px;}
#log-0{ background-color : #ffffff; } /* ランキング順位 */
#log-1{ background-color : #ffffff; } /* タイトル */
#log-2{ background-color : #ffffff; } /* カテゴリ */
#log-3{ background-color:#FFFFFF; } /* 紹介文 */
#log-4{ background-color:#FFFFFF; } /* 管理人コメント */

#mid-bar{ background-color : #cccccc; 
  color : #ffffff;
} /* 中段バー */

.head{
  border-bottom-width : 10px;
  border-bottom-style : solid;
  border-bottom-color : greenyellow;  /*一番上の色*/
  border-top-width : 0px;
  border-top-style : solid;
  padding-top : 5px;
  padding-bottom : 5px;

  text-align : left;
}
.td-1{
  font-size : 13px;
  
  
border-width : 0px 0px 1px 0px;border-style : solid solid dotted solid;border-color : greenyellowyellow #999999 #999999 #999999;  /*トップ上の線*/
  
}
.td-2{
  font-size : 13px;
}
.td-3{
  font-size : 13px;
border-width : 1px 1px 1px 1px;border-style : solid solid solid solid;border-color : #cccccc #cccccc #cccccc #cccccc;
  background-color : #d6ffac;
}
.td-4{
  font-size : 13px;
}
.td-5{width:300px;padding:5px 30px 5px 5px;
  font-size : 13px;
border-width : 0px 0px 1px 0px;border-style : solid solid solid solid;border-color : #afff60 #afff60 greenyellow #afff60; /*3つめトップカテゴリ下の線*/
  line-height : 24px;
}
.td-6{
  font-size : 12px;
  line-height : 25px;
}
.b-2{
  font-size : 15px;
  color : #666666;
}
.table1{
  font-size : 14px;
}
.foam{
  font-size : 13px;
border-width : 1px 1px 1px 1px;border-style : solid solid solid solid;border-color : #666666 #666666 #666666 #666666;
  margin-top : 5px;
  margin-left : 5px;
  margin-right : 5px;
  margin-bottom : 5px;
}
.title-bar{
  color : #ffffff;
  
border-width : 5px 0px 5px 0px;border-style : solid solid solid solid;border-color : greenyellow #009ce8 greenyellow #009ce8; /*トップ上のタイトル色*/
  padding-top : 5px;
  padding-left : 5px;
  padding-right : 5px;
  padding-bottom : 5px;
  background-color : #aaaaaa;  /*その背景*/
}
.b-3{
  font-size : 14px;
  color : #ffffff;
}
FONT{
  font-size : 13px;
}

.td-u{
  padding-bottom : 3px;
  padding-top : 3px;
  padding-left : 3px;
  padding-right : 3px;
}

.topobi{
font-size : 13px;color : #ffffff;background-color : greenyellow;  /*トップのタイトル*/
}